Lydia L,  Beauty Editor/Writer


A native of the tropical island of Singapore, is a 9 year veteran in the makeup and hair industries. She spent her childhood between Asia and Canada, and now resides in Texas. A love for the arts and the creative, eventually led to her passion for makeup.  She has worked on many projects in her career including weddings, pageants, music videos, makeup lessons, and hair and fashion shows. She also enjoys helping women find their own personal makeup style. Working for MAC Cosmetics for six years helped perfect her craft, and shaped her into an independent thinker when it comes to makeup.
There are two things she stresses with makeup: One, there are no rules, just guidelines that you can choose to follow. Daytime or nighttime make-up are not in her vocab. You can sport a smoky eye during the day and you can wear a red lipstick proudly at 10am, just as much as you can wear neutral colours at night. Second, you can wear EVERY colour in the rainbow. It’s just a matter of finding the right shade, tone, and intensity that fits your taste.
Besides painting faces and styling hair, Lydia also enjoys cooking, watching documentaries & comedies, cuddling with her cat Leo, finding good deals on the clearance rack and trying out the latest and greatest in makeup and beauty. She gets inspiration from all things around her and she loves seeing that light bulb go off in someone’s head when she teaches the craft of makeup application.
